The Father
Our heavenly Father is the giver of every good gift and also knows everything that we need. This means that we can rely on Him to provide for us without worrying and striving.
Use these verses to worship and adore Him for who He is, what He’s done, and ask Him to help you live a life that pleases Him and brings Him glory. Read the scriptures as prayers of worship, thanksgiving, and supplication, believing there is power in every declaration.
James 1:17 AMP
17 Every good thing given and every perfect gift is from above; it comes down from the Father of lights [the Creator and Sustainer of the heavens], in whom there is no variation [no rising or setting] or shadow [a]cast by His turning [for He is perfect and never changes].
John 14:2 NLT
2 There is more than enough room in my Father’s home.[a] If this were not so, would I have told you that I am going to prepare a place for you?[b]
Luke 12:29-30 ESV
29 And do not seek what you are to eat and what you are to drink, nor be worried.
30 For all the nations of the world seek after these things, and your Father knows that you need them.
